WebWhile I wouldn’t suggest rolling off too high into the human range of hearing, a simple low-end cleanup trick to use a high-pass set to something below 100 Hz. It shouldn’t affect your sound too much, but if you feel like you’re sacrificing useful bass content to clean up the mud, just set it lower until you find low-end equilibrium. WebMay 25, 2024 · A high-pass filter (HPF) is also called a low cut because it cuts the low end of the frequency spectrum. Or you could say it like this: A high-pass filter lets the high frequencies pass through the filter by removing some low-end frequencies. WebMar 5, 2024 · Q: I saw the Tech Tip about using a high-pass filter when mixing to clean up the low end. Should I also be using a low-pass filter to clean up the high end? A: If there is noise or other problematic material in the highs that you would like to remove, then a low-pass filter may be of benefit. However, it is often harder to clean up the highs using a …
